    Need to access a deceased family member's computer


    Hi,


    This year had a family member who died from cancer. I want to access their laptop to clean out the computer, close down any accounts they had and end their email coming in, things like that. Problem is someone tossed out the book that had their passwords including the one to unlock Windows on startup. Is there a way to get into the computer? Thanks.

    Microsoft does have a process in place for when these sad circumstances happen:

    You can learn more about Microsoft's Next of Kin process here.

    Occasionally, family members or third parties may need to request email account data in the event of a customer’s death or medical incapacitation. We realize that these may be difficult times for those seeking access to their loved one’s information.
    However, the right to privacy and the security of our customers’ data is a fundamental concern to Microsoft. Our users expect Microsoft to keep their information private and secure even in the event of death or incapacitation. Our primary responsibility
    is to honor this expectation.


    If a third party has a compelling need to access a user’s account and he or she has appropriate legal permission for this access, or have additional questions about access to a deceased or incapacitated user’s account, please send inquiries to
    L: msrecord@microsoft.com
